[SCM] Samba Shared Repository - branch master updated

Jelmer Vernooij jelmer at samba.org
Sun May 30 20:22:20 MDT 2010


The branch, master has been updated
       via  04fc459... tdb-waf: Don't install binaries when using system tdb.
       via  e6129bd... tdb-waf: Simplify manpage handling.
      from  1d1d31f... wafsamba: Default blacklist to an empty list rather than None.

http://gitweb.samba.org/?p=samba.git;a=shortlog;h=master


- Log -----------------------------------------------------------------
commit 04fc459a301c09d027e2d484b9a4e0737819b093
Author: Jelmer Vernooij <jelmer at samba.org>
Date:   Mon May 31 04:20:44 2010 +0200

    tdb-waf: Don't install binaries when using system tdb.

commit e6129bd59650b921e51d5b8aa10246778aacdd30
Author: Jelmer Vernooij <jelmer at samba.org>
Date:   Mon May 31 04:16:19 2010 +0200

    tdb-waf: Simplify manpage handling.

-----------------------------------------------------------------------

Summary of changes:
 lib/tdb/wscript |   41 ++++++++++++++---------------------------
 1 files changed, 14 insertions(+), 27 deletions(-)


Changeset truncated at 500 lines:

diff --git a/lib/tdb/wscript b/lib/tdb/wscript
index 084be40..6af3897 100644
--- a/lib/tdb/wscript
+++ b/lib/tdb/wscript
@@ -71,22 +71,23 @@ def build(bld):
                           hide_symbols=True,
                           vnum=VERSION, is_bundled=not bld.env.standalone_tdb)
 
-    bld.SAMBA_BINARY('tdbtorture',
-                     'tools/tdbtorture.c',
-                     'tdb',
-                     install=False)
+        bld.SAMBA_BINARY('tdbtorture',
+                         'tools/tdbtorture.c',
+                         'tdb',
+                         install=False)
 
-    bld.SAMBA_BINARY('tdbdump',
-                     'tools/tdbdump.c',
-                     'tdb')
+        bld.SAMBA_BINARY('tdbdump',
+                         'tools/tdbdump.c',
+                         'tdb', manpages='manpages/tdbdump.8')
 
-    bld.SAMBA_BINARY('tdbbackup',
-                     'tools/tdbbackup.c',
-                     'tdb')
+        bld.SAMBA_BINARY('tdbbackup',
+                         'tools/tdbbackup.c',
+                         'tdb',
+                         manpages='manpages/tdbbackup.8')
 
-    bld.SAMBA_BINARY('tdbtool',
-                     'tools/tdbtool.c',
-                     'tdb')
+        bld.SAMBA_BINARY('tdbtool',
+                         'tools/tdbtool.c',
+                         'tdb', manpages='manpages/tdbtool.8')
 
     s4_build = getattr(bld.env, '_SAMBA_BUILD_', 0) == 4
 
@@ -101,20 +102,6 @@ def build(bld):
         bld.PKG_CONFIG_FILES('tdb.pc', vnum=VERSION)
         bld.INSTALL_FILES('${INCLUDEDIR}', 'include/tdb.h', flat=True)
 
-        if bld.env.XSLTPROC:
-            manpages = 'manpages/tdbbackup.8 manpages/tdbdump.8 manpages/tdbtool.8'
-
-            bld.env.TDB_MAN_XSL = 'http://docbook.sourceforge.net/release/xsl/current/manpages/docbook.xsl'
-
-            for m in manpages.split():
-                source = m + '.xml'
-                bld.SAMBA_GENERATOR(m,
-                                    source=source,
-                                    target=m,
-                                    rule='${XSLTPROC} -o ${TGT} ${TDB_MAN_XSL} ${SRC}'
-                                    )
-                bld.INSTALL_FILES('${MANDIR}/man8', m, flat=True)
-
 
 def test(ctx):
     '''run tdb testsuite'''


-- 
Samba Shared Repository


More information about the samba-cvs mailing list